Historically, racism and poverty have made it more difficult for marginalized groups in Texas to receive equal opportunities. These issues have led to systemic inequalities in education, employment, housing, and healthcare, perpetuating cycles of poverty and disenfranchisement. Additionally, discriminatory practices have limited access to resources and opportunities for marginalized communities, further exacerbating the challenges they face in achieving social and economic mobility.
